A Church Community on the move....
A welcome change is about to take place in one of Kidderminster's
town churches, a change which we trust will bring new impetus and
focus in its mission. What makes this project so special is that it
is ecumenically based, providing a place of spiritual refreshment
and challenge in our community. It comes at a time when the town centre
is undergoing a major regeneration, and is testimony to the fact that
the Church of God is involved in the business of change, and is always
ready to respond to new challenges.
And what a challenge we have on our hands! Since our last public meeting
at Baxter in January 2001, a great deal has happened. A small committee
have been meeting on a regular basis to examine the process which
needs to be undertaken for a project of this size. We have been in
contact with a number of individuals have have shown great enthusiasm
in sharing their expertise with us, and helping to draw our attention
to the issues that need to be dealt with in preparation.
One of the key areas for our committee to be concerned about has been
the issue of fund-raising. We have had a number of choirs approach
us about concerts for the Baxter Project, and the first to perform
at a concert in Baxter in December were the Valentines and the New
Dimensional Experience choirs. Our special thanks to all who made
the evening a very special occasion. We raised just over £1500, bring
the total funds raised to just over £2000. A Charitable Company account
has been applied for, and the Committee are now in the process of
forging links with various groups in the town who may well be interested
in supporting our project.
